Actor Dalip Tahil sentenced to two months jail in 2018 drunk driving case

As per a report on Live Mint, ‘relying on the evidence of the doctor who opined that smell of the alcohol was found and pupils were dilated’, a magistrate's court convicted Dalip Tahil. At the time of his arrest in 2018, the actor had refused to give his blood samples to the police for alcohol test.

Dalip’s car had rammed into an autorickshaw, injuring two passengers. He attempted to flee but was caught in a traffic jam caused by Ganesh Visarjan processions. The passengers reportedly caught up with Dalip’s car and confronted him. He is said to have got into an argument and pushed them around. The actor was taken into custody after the police was summoned.

The passengers were identified as Jenita Gandhi, 21, and Gaurav Chugh, 22.

“The impact of the collision caused Ms Gandhi sustain a severe jolt to her back and neck. Ms Gandhi and Mr Chugh got off the autorickshaw and saw the car trying to flee towards Santacruz. The car could not get far as the street was crowded due to Ganeshotsav immersion processions,” an officer with the Khar police told the Hindu.
